METHOD FOR MANUFACTURING SODIUM SULFATE, GYPSUM, ALUMINUM HYDROXIDE BASED ON SODIUM ALUMINUM SULFATE CAPABLE OF COST-EFFECTIVELY IMPLEMENTING MANUFACTURING PROCESSES WITH RESPECT TO POLYSILICON

PURPOSE: A method for manufacturing sodium sulfate, gypsum, aluminum hydroxide based on sodium aluminum sulfate is provided to prevent the generation of impurities by treating sodium aluminum sulfate(NaAl(SO_4)_2) based on ammonia and calcium oxide.;CONSTITUTION: Sodium aluminum sulfate is introduced into the mixture of water and ammonia in order to obtain sodium sulfate and aluminum hydroxide. The reactant is filtered to obtain a filtered solution. The filtered solution is reacted with calcium oxide under pH 6.5 or less and a reacting temperature of 60-90 degrees Celsius in order to obtain gypsum(CaSO_4·2H_2O). Ammonia gas generated from the reaction is separately collected and re-circulated. The sodium aluminum sulfate is obtained as a byproduct from a polysilicon processing process.;COPYRIGHT KIPO 2012
